Current PSD (Web/Data Status). PSD has undergone major URL restructuring so that all URLs start with http://www.esrl.noaa.gov/psd/ (More Info).
 

Boulder Daily Weather data from the NOAA/NWS Cooperative Site

From 1897 to present (text)
1940-1949
1950-1959
1960-1969
1970-1979
1980-1989
1990-1999
present
Pages are for curiosity only; there are no guarantees that the data is correct.